Evidence supporting the use of: Vitamin E (mixied tocopherols and tocotrienols)
For the body system: Muscles
Synopsis
Source of validity: Scientific
Rating (out of 5): 2
Vitamin E, comprising mixed tocopherols and tocotrienols, has been studied for its potential role in supporting the muscular system, primarily due to its antioxidant properties. Oxidative stress is known to contribute to muscle damage and delayed recovery, especially following intense exercise. Vitamin E, as a lipid-soluble antioxidant, can help neutralize free radicals generated in muscle tissues during physical activity. Some animal studies and small-scale human trials have indicated that Vitamin E supplementation may reduce exercise-induced oxidative damage, muscle soreness, and markers of muscle injury, such as creatine kinase levels. Additionally, deficiencies in Vitamin E are associated with muscle weakness and neuromuscular problems, providing further rationale for its role in muscle health.
However, the evidence from large, well-controlled human trials is mixed. While some studies show modest benefits in athletes or elderly populations, others have failed to demonstrate significant improvements in muscle strength, recovery, or performance compared to placebo. The benefits, when observed, tend to be minor and more pronounced in individuals with low baseline Vitamin E status rather than the general population.
In summary, while there is some scientific basis for the use of Vitamin E to support muscle health, particularly due to its antioxidant effects and importance in preventing deficiency-related muscle problems, the overall evidence for substantial benefits in muscle function or recovery in healthy individuals is limited. Therefore, the evidence rating is moderate to low.
